What Is a Rack Mounted Battery?

A rack mounted battery is an energy storage unit specifically engineered to be installed in a standard 19-inch server rack. These systems typically use lithium-ion battery technology—most often Lithium Iron Phosphate (LiFePO4)—due to its high energy density, long lifespan, and superior safety features.


Each battery unit, or module, is self-contained with its own Battery Management System (BMS). The BMS is crucial for monitoring the health of the battery, protecting it from overcharging or deep discharging, balancing the cells, and ensuring safe, efficient operation. The modular design is one of the biggest advantages; you can easily connect multiple units in parallel to increase the total energy storage capacity as your power needs grow. This makes rack mounted batteries a highly scalable and flexible solution.


Key Benefits of Using a Rack Mounted Battery

Choosing a rack mounted battery system offers several significant advantages over other types of battery storage.


Space Efficiency and Organization

One of the most apparent benefits is the space-saving design. By fitting neatly into standard server racks, these batteries help maintain a clean, organized, and professional-looking installation. This is particularly important in environments where space is limited, such as in data centers, network closets, or residential utility rooms. The vertical stacking capability maximizes storage capacity within a minimal footprint.


Scalability and Flexibility

The modular nature of rack mounted batteries allows for incredible flexibility. You can start with a single battery module and add more units in parallel as your energy requirements increase. This "pay-as-you-go" approach means you don't have to invest in a large, oversized system from the beginning. This scalability is perfect for growing businesses or homeowners planning future expansions, like adding more solar panels.


High Performance and Longevity

Modern rack mounted batteries, especially those using LiFePO4 chemistry like the systems from Super Battery New Energy, deliver outstanding performance. They are known for their long cycle life, often providing thousands of charge-discharge cycles before their capacity begins to degrade significantly. They also feature a high depth of discharge (DoD), meaning you can use more of the battery's stored energy in each cycle without damaging it. This translates to a reliable, long-term investment that will provide power for many years.


Enhanced Safety

Safety is a top priority for any battery system. Reputable rack mounted batteries come with an integrated BMS that provides comprehensive protection against common issues like over-voltage, under-voltage, short circuits, and extreme temperatures. LiFePO4 chemistry is also inherently safer and more thermally stable than other lithium-ion variants, significantly reducing the risk of thermal runaway.

Common Applications for Rack Mounted Batteries

The versatility of rack mounted battery systems makes them suitable for a diverse set of applications, from commercial to residential.


Solar Energy Storage

For homes and businesses with solar panel installations, a rack mounted battery is an excellent way to store excess energy generated during the day. This stored power can then be used at night or during periods of low sunlight, increasing self-consumption and reducing reliance on the grid. It also provides a reliable backup power source during grid outages.


Data Centers and IT Infrastructure

Data centers require a constant, stable power supply to prevent data loss and equipment damage. Rack mounted batteries can be integrated into an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S) system to provide immediate backup power in the event of an outage, allowing for a seamless transition until primary power is restored or generators kick in.


Telecommunications

Cell towers and other telecommunications infrastructure need dependable backup power to remain operational during grid failures. The compact and scalable design of rack mounted batteries makes them an ideal solution for these remote sites, ensuring continuous communication services for everyone.


Off-Grid and Remote Power Systems

In locations without access to a reliable electrical grid, rack mounted batteries are essential components of off-grid power systems. When combined with solar panels or other renewable energy sources, they can provide consistent, clean power for homes, cabins, or remote industrial operations.


How to Choose the Right Rack Mounted Battery System

With many options on the market, selecting the right rack mounted battery requires careful consideration of a few key factors.


First, calculate your energy needs. Determine how much power you consume daily and how long you need backup power to last. This will help you size your battery bank correctly. Second, check the compatibility of the battery with your inverter. The battery and inverter must be able to communicate effectively, so it’s crucial to choose models that are compatible with each other. Brands like Super Battery New Energy often provide lists of compatible inverters.


Finally, compare the specifications of different models. Look at factors like cycle life, depth of discharge, warranty, and safety certifications. A longer warranty and higher cycle life are usually indicative of a higher-quality, more durable product.


The table below compares key features of a typical rack mounted battery.

Feature

Specification

Description

Battery Chemistry

Lithium Iron Phosphate (LiFePO4)

Known for its safety, long lifespan, and thermal stability.

Nominal Voltage

48V / 51.2V

The standard voltage for many solar and backup power systems, ensuring wide inverter compatibility.

Energy Capacity

5 kWh - 10 kWh per module

The amount of energy a single battery module can store.

Depth of Discharge

80%

The percentage of the battery's capacity that can be safely used without causing significant degradation.

Cycle Life

6000+ cycles @ 80% DoD

The number of charge/discharge cycles the battery can endure before its capacity drops to a certain level.

Scalability

Up to 16 units in parallel

Allows you to easily expand your storage capacity by adding more battery modules.

Warranty

10 years

The manufacturer's guarantee for the product's performance and longevity.

Communication

CAN / RS485

Communication protocols that enable the battery to connect with compatible inverters and monitoring systems.
